The Four Paws Walk Over Wooden Dog Gate is a stylish and functional solution for pet containment, expanding from 30 to 44 inches wide and standing 18 inches high. Its pressure-mounted design ensures no wall damage, while the elegant varnished wood adds a touch of sophistication to your home.

Great for narrower openings
I installed this on an opening that is just a bit wider than a standard bedroom doorway and it feels very strong and durable. We actually have three other gates that are used at different times and locations in the house, this is one of the stronger feeling ones. My guess on the reviewers who commented about it being flimsy or getting broken is that they had it on a much wider opening. When it's opened to it's limit, or near, it doesn't have nearly the support as when it's down to 30" or close. There were no instructions, but it's pretty simple to figure out, especially if you've used a gate similar to this before. The adjusters on the side work great, getting it more secure than any of the other non-permanent gates I've used. You can put quite a bit of weight on it and it won't budge. The only area I can see having a weakness is the little wooden adjuster pegs that help keep it in place. I can see those breaking pretty early but if it happens I'll probably just put a screw into both railings to keep it from sliding, since I have no plans on using it in other locations that aren't the same width. The little opening works great also, and feels plenty secure.

Works wonderfully
Opening and closing pet door all the time was getting to be a really bother. My dogs are small enough that this was a great solution. It is made of solid wood that withstood much chewing and they lost interest in chewing through before it broke. My only complaint is that the latch on the little door is of low quality and takes a bit too much concentration to use over and over. the hole that the spring loaded pin goes into is very small. Also the screw feet that press into the door frame to keep it in place fall out easily when you choose to take the gate down to clean the floor or something. Not a big problem but it keeps happening and I am afraid I'll lose one at some point.
